Requirements for Car Rental in UAE

Renting a car is fairly straightforward, but the documentation varies depending on your residency status.

For Tourists:

  • Valid passport

  • Visit visa

  • International Driving Permit (IDP) or license from an approved country

  • Credit card for deposit and payments

For Residents:

  • Valid UAE driving license

  • Emirates ID

  • Credit card or post-dated cheques, depending on the agency’s requirements

Rental Cost Breakdown

Rental prices vary by vehicle type, duration, and season. Here’s a general range to expect:

  • Compact cars – AED 60–120/day

  • SUVs – AED 150–400/day

  • Luxury cars – AED 500–1,500/day

  • Monthly rentals – Starting from AED 1,200/month for basic models

Insurance and Liability

Insurance is a crucial part of any rental agreement. Make sure you understand what’s included:

  • Third-party liability – Usually included by default

  • Collision Damage Waiver (CDW) – Optional but recommended

  • Personal Accident Insurance – Covers medical expenses in case of injury

  • Theft protection – Especially useful for luxury vehicles

Navigating UAE Roads: What to Expect

Driving in the UAE is straightforward but differs slightly from other countries. Here are some important things to note:

  • Speed limits – 60–80 km/h in cities, up to 140 km/h on highways

  • Salik tolls – Automated toll gates in Dubai; charges are usually billed separately by rental agencies

  • Parking – Mostly paid in urban areas. Use SMS or mobile apps for quick payment

  • Fines – Traffic violations result in fines that will be passed on to you as the renter, so always drive responsibly

Practical Tips Before You Hit the Road

  • Fuel Policy – Most rentals are full-to-full; return the car with a full tank to avoid charges

  • Inspect the Vehicle – Note any existing scratches or dents before you drive off

  • Understand the Contract – Read the fine print for late return policies, extra charges, and cancellation terms

  • Add-ons – If you’re traveling with kids, book a child seat in advance

Also, remember that traffic can get heavy in cities like Dubai during peak hours, so plan accordingly.
